The situation on site

Joined the project during the finishing phase — after blockwork was complete — to supervise structural and finishing works across a social housing development at scale. Started with responsibility for 8 buildings, then 12, then 18, then all 36. During periods when the project manager was on leave, full sole site authority for the entire 36-tower site was held — with only phone follow-up from the PM. The challenge at this scale is consistency: keeping quality, inspection readiness and subcontractor discipline uniform across dozens of simultaneous fronts, without losing control of any individual building.

What I specifically did

01 Progressed from supervising 8 buildings to full responsibility for all 36 towers — demonstrating the ability to scale oversight and maintain consistent quality standards as scope grew.
02 Held sole site authority during PM absence — full site responsibility across 36 towers, covering all trades, inspections, subcontractor management and daily decision-making.
03 Supervised structural and finishing activities across towers — columns, slabs, blockwork and plaster — ensuring all execution followed approved drawings and specifications.
04 Followed up on WIRs and MIRs to ensure timely inspection of works and materials — coordinating with the consultant on approvals and technical clarifications for site issues.
05 Monitored site progress against the overall plan — highlighting delays, sequencing constraints and resource gaps to the project engineer and maintaining momentum across multiple fronts.
06 Supervised subcontractors daily across all active buildings — resolving technical issues directly on site and maintaining safety and housekeeping standards across active work zones.
07 Prepared daily and weekly site reports summarising progress, manpower levels and key issues across all towers — maintaining clear documentation discipline throughout the project.
08 Supported punch-list and snagging activities — following up on rectification across apartments and common areas prior to handover stages for each completed building.
